Castro de Sobreira
Castro de Sobreira is a peak in Candedo, Murça Municipality, Vila Real District and has an elevation of 553 metres. Castro de Sobreira is situated nearby to the hamlet Milhais, as well as near the neighborhood Bairro da Portela.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Vila Boa
Village
Vila Boa is a former civil parish and village in the municipality of Mirandela. It had 9,33 km² of area and 90 inhabitants. It was established on 22 April 1957 after leaving the Franco parish and in 28 January 2013 it merged with Franco once more to form the new Franco e Vila Boa parish.
